About Lightera
Lightera is a global leader in optical fiber and connectivity solutions delivering innovative technologies that drive communication networks data centers and specialty photonics applications. With a deep legacy of expertise in optical science we provide high-performance solutions that enable faster more reliable and more sustainable connections for businesses communities and industries worldwide.
Headquartered in Norcross, Georgia U.S.A. Lightera operates with a global footprint serving customers across telecommunications enterprise industrial generative AI data centers 5G6G utilities medical aerospace defense and sensing markets. Lightera is part of Furukawa Electric Group a multi-billion-dollar leader in optical communications.
